Online alarm clock is a web tool designed to alert an individual or group at a specified time. It is similar to an online countdown timer, but the difference is that online timers are used for time duration, whereas online alarms are used for specific times. Online alarm clocks don't require special devices or special software (alarm clock app) installed on your computer, notebook or mobile phone. We need only access to the internet and a web browser. We don't always have our mobile phones on us or we are not always allowed to use them and the installation of applications is not always the optimal solution. We can set an alarm clock for a specific time - hour and minute. When the time comes and the info message appears than the online alarm starts ringing.

No. The alarm only runs while the page is open in your browser. Keep the tab with the alarm active (or at least the browser open) for the alarm to sound. On some devices, sleep mode or locking the screen can also stop sound.
Yes. Each alarm time can have its own ringtone and message. Use the settings (gear) button to choose a sound and add a label or note. These settings are saved automatically when you start the alarm.
Select the hour and minute you want the alarm to go off. Optionally open settings to set a sound and message. Click "Start alarm" to activate. The widget will show a countdown until the alarm rings.
Yes. The online alarm works in mobile browsers. Note: some phones mute or pause sound when the browser is in the background or the screen is locked, so keep the page visible or check your device settings for best results.
The alarm only runs while the page is open. Keep the browser tab with the alarm active (and avoid closing the browser or putting the device to sleep). On PCs, sleep mode can stop the alarm—disable sleep or keep the alarm tab visible. Test the alarm before use and ensure your volume is on. On mobile, keep the app in the foreground or the screen on for reliable ringing.
